sarcodina
Noun
-
Characterized by the formation of pseudopods for locomotion and taking food: Actinopoda;
Rhizopoda (synset 101392516)is a type of: class - (biology) a taxonomic group containing one or more ordersmember holonym:- sarcodine, sarcodinian - protozoa that move and capture food by forming pseudopods
- actinopoda, subclass actinopoda - heliozoans; radiolarians
- rhizopoda, subclass rhizopoda - creeping protozoans: amoebas and foraminifers
belongs to: phylum protozoa, protozoa - in some classifications considered a superphylum or a subkingdom; comprises flagellates; ciliates; sporozoans; amoebas; foraminiferssame as: class sarcodina
